What You Need to Know About an Operator Before Booking a Danbury Charter
Safety comes first, so look for ARGUS Gold or Wyvern certifications when reviewing operators for Danbury flights, ensuring high standards for your trip to places like Tarrywile Park. This helps in picking secure charter choices that match your needs, avoiding risks in varying weather like snowy conditions.
Aircraft details matter too, from size to features, letting you match options to group trips or solo ventures, perhaps linking to manufacturing hubs for efficient visits. Knowing operator expertise means better decisions on flight options, keeping things reliable for local explorations.

A Local’s Guide to Flying Private to and from Danbury
Danbury Municipal Airport offers a straightforward setup with a 4,300-foot runway, perfect for various aircraft, and FBO services that make arrivals smooth, especially after dealing with winter weather.
